West Roxbury, MA — Corrib Pub 5K Road Race

The Corrib Pub 5K Road Race in West Roxbury was held on Sunday, June 3rd, 2007.  TheRace Start race is held annually and this was the 14th race. The race is fun for me because it is my regular running route , 3 miles with one steep hill on Corey Street, and yes the rolling hills of Bellevue Hill seem unending when you are finishing your last mile. They have  DJ  Dave at the beginning who gets you motivated with the singing of the National Anthem, the fire trucks are present at the beginning and the American Flag drapes over us at the starting line.   Race MapI understand this year they had over 1700 runners and lots of cheering on the rout–and water tables to help those of us that need a reason to stop along the way .

There is a lot of support from the community and the Corrib Pub who supports many local charities and local youth organizations.  They have raised over $510,000 from this event from which our community and children have benefited.  It ’s great to see so many volunteers each year working hard to make it the success it is today. There is a complimentary cook-out afterward in Billings Field, with all the hamburgers and hot dogs you can eat, entertainment and children’s activities, a great day had by all and a few sore muscles afterward.  To get more information their website is www.coolrunning.com.  Thanks to all the volunteers and family and friends that cheered us on along the way.
